Skip to main content

Posts

Showing posts from December, 2019

Belajar OpenCV Python : Install

Requirement Visual Studio Code :  https://code.visualstudio.com/ Python :  https://www.python.org/ Download saja yang versi terbaru Langkah Instalasi 1. Install semua requirement, * Note : Ceklis Pip saat install python 2. Setelah install semua, Buka cmd ketik  " python --version " untuk cek apakah python sudah terinstall. 3. pip --version ;  untuk cek apakah pip sudah terinstall apa belum. 4. Install openCV dengan perintah pip install opencv-python nanti akan mendownload file dependencies secara otomatis, diantaranya OpenCV dan Numpy. 5. Cek apakah OpenCV dan Numpy sudah terinstall dengan benar dengan masuk ke python command line dengan ketik py sehingga muncul tanda >>. Happy Coding VScode belum dipake ya dalam instalasi ini 😶 Saran : Download OpenCV Repository juga di GitHub.

3D Rotational Matrix (Matriks rotasi 3 dimensi) Roll, Pitch, dan Yaw

Rotasi 3 Dimensi adalah berputarnya sebuah benda sebuah objek dari keadaan awal ke keadaan akhir.  3 Dimensi disini mengacu pada sudut euler atau tiga jenis sudut rotasi (ϕ,θ,ψ) pada sistem koordinat.  Roll(ϕ) adalah jenis rotasi yang dilakukan pada sumbu X Pitch(θ) adalah rotasi yang dilakukan pada sumbu Y Yaw(ψ) adalah rotasi yang dilakukan pada sumbu Z Gambar 1 Ilustrasi Roll, Pitch, Yaw Pada Pesawat Terbang Misalkan pada pesawat terbang dengan melihat kerangka acuan pada bumi, maka pesawat dapat berotasi pada sumbu X,Y dan Z secara simultan. Sebenarnya ada 6 kombinasi dalam melihat rotasi 3 dimensi ini (cek wiki ) Persamaan rotasi untuk kombinasi z,y,x Persamaan tersebut terdiri dari rotasi pada masing-masing sumbu dalam R^3 berturut-turut yaitu yaw, pitch dan roll. Tinjau 3 sumbu dalam R^3 Untuk Roll, Misalkan,  Rotasi pada sumbu X(Roll), maka gunakan YZ Plane, didapat, Sehingga, Untuk Pitch, Misalkan, Rotasi pada sumbu Y(Pitc